TP观察钱包为何不显示余额?从多链索引、授权与算力到提现稳定性的排查路线图

当用户在TP里“观察钱包”(watch-only)却发现余额不显示时,直觉会认为是应用故障。实际上这类问题更常见于数据链路的某一环没有完成:钱包地址已存在链上资产,但余额在界面上未被正确“索引—解析—聚合”。下面用科普式思路,把排查流程拆开讲清楚。

首先确认钱包类型与可见范围。观察钱包通常不需要私钥签名,但仍依赖外部索引服务读取地址历史交易并推导当前余额。如果所观察地址并非你以为的“同一条链地址”(例如在ETH与其兼容链上地址相同字节形式却属于不同网络),就会出现“有资产但当前网络看不到”的情况。建议在TP里切换到目标链(如EVM链/比特币类链)后再刷新。

二是检查链上是否真的“有可读资产”。有些资产是合约代币(ERC-20/其他标准),余额能否显示取决于代币合约是否被索引服务支持,以及你是否将该代币加入到可显示列表。有的索引只抓取常见事件或依赖代币列表缓存,导致“小众代币”余额不更新。此时可尝试用链上浏览器核对地址代币转账事件是否存在,并查看合约是否正确。

三是关注“授权与解析”类因素。对观察钱包来说它不签名,但仍可能需要读取代币合约的余额方法或调用代币元数据。若应用侧对特定合约方法做了兼容限制,或合约升级导致返回结构变化,就可能出现解析失败。你可以把问题缩小到单一资产:只看某一种代币/币种是否都不显示,还是仅某些代币不显示。若只有少数不显示,通常是解析/支持范围问题,而非地址本身。

四是处理索引延迟与算力相关的“刷新窗口”。区块确认与索引服务抓取存在延迟:交易已上链,但索引没来得及更新;或者节点背后使用了多源聚合,某一源算力不足导致数据滞后。此时反复刷新未必立刻生效,建议等待几分钟到数小时,并尝试切换“数据源/浏览器模式”(若TP提供)。

五是验证是否被“多链资产管理”的聚合策略过滤。多链钱包往往会把不同链的资产汇总到统一视图,过滤条件包括最小展示精度、白名单代币、交易类型筛选等。若你近期只收到了某类资产(例如跨链桥释放尚在确认中,或是被路由合约托管),聚合模块可能暂时不展示。可在链详情页查看原始余额是否存在。

六是最后一步:便捷资金提现前的安全确认。余额不显示并不等于资产不存在,但在提现前必须确认两点:第一,资产在目标链上确实可转出(合约余额可用、无冻结/托管限制);第二,提现地址与网络匹配,避免把链上资产“转错网络”。若确认无误仍无法显示,才考虑联系TP支持并提供:地址、链名、交易哈希、资产合约地址。

高度概括地说,TP观察钱包不显示余额通常是“网络/链选择错误、代币解析支持不足、索引延迟、聚合过滤策略”中的一种或多种叠加。用上述流程逐层定位,你就能把问题从“像坏了”变成“可解释、可修复”。

更进一步的创新启示是:智能商业服务若要真正提升资金提现体验,就必须把“索引健康度、解析成功率、跨链确认状态”做成可视化指标,让用户在余额之前就能看到数据通道的可靠性。这样,技术的透明度会成为新一代钱包体验的一部分。

作者:澄海数据室发布时间:2026-05-18 09:49:47

评论

NovaLin

排查思路很实用,尤其是“链选择”和“索引延迟”这两点以前没想到。

小岚酱

科普得清楚:观察钱包依赖索引服务推导余额,怪不得不一定立刻更新。

ByteRanger

多链资产聚合的过滤条件也可能导致“看不见”,建议补充具体在哪个页面查看原始余额。

Crypto月光

写得很细,提现前确认可转出与网络匹配这句太关键了。

MingWeiZ

如果只有个别代币不显示,基本就是解析/支持范围问题,这个判断我记住了。

相关阅读